In the United States and lots of other developed countries, medical licensing is a function of the state or regional government. While the authority stays with these boards, the administration has moved practically totally online. For visit website (MD or DO), a nurse practitioner (NP), or a physician assistant (PA), the online process is not a shortcut around the requirements of medical education and residency; rather, it is a digital gateway to send qualifications for rigorous evaluation.
The FSMB serves as a main hub for medical licensing in the U.S. Through its Federation Credentials Verification Service (FCVS), it enables practitioners to produce a long-term, verified electronic portfolio of their primary source credentials. This consists of medical school records, postgraduate training, and assessment scores. When confirmed, this online profile can be sent out to several state boards, considerably minimizing the administrative burden on the applicant.

One of the most significant developments for the "legit medical license online" movement is the IMLC. The Compact is a contract among getting involved U.S. states to simplify the licensing process for doctors who wish to practice in numerous jurisdictions.
Under this system, a physician's info is vetted by their "State of Principal License." When cleared, they can use the IMLC online website to make an application for licenses in other member states nearly immediately. This has been a game-changer for the growth of telehealth, permitting medical professionals to reach clients in rural or underserved locations across state lines lawfully and efficiently.

Costs differ considerably by state. A lot of states charge in between ₤ 300 and ₤ 1,000 for a preliminary application, plus additional charges for background checks and credential verification (FCVS).
Yes. IMGs must first be certified by the Educational Commission for Foreign Medical Graduates (ECFMG). As soon as certified, they follow the same online application protocols as U.S. graduates, though they might have extra confirmation actions for their global records.
The majority of licenses should be renewed every one to two years. The renewal process is generally dealt with totally online through the state board's website and needs the doctor to testify to finishing a particular variety of Continuing Medical Education (CME) hours.
Denials can occur due to incomplete documentation, concealed disciplinary actions, criminal history, or failure to satisfy the specific state's residency length requirements.
